Phasmophobia System Requirements

The official minimum and recommended PC specs for Phasmophobia, component by component.

ComponentMinimumRecommended
OSWindows 10 64BitWindows 10 64Bit
ProcessorIntel Core i5-4590 / AMD Ryzen 5 2600Intel Core i5-10600 / AMD Ryzen 5 3600
Memory8 GB RAM8 GB RAM
GraphicsNVIDIA GTX 970 / AMD Radeon R9 390NVIDIA RTX 2060 / AMD Radeon RX 5700
DirectXVersion 11Version 11
Storage21 GB available space21 GB available space

Minimum

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system OS: Windows 10 64Bit Processor: Intel Core i5-4590 / AMD Ryzen 5 2600 Memory: 8 GB RAM Graphics: NVIDIA GTX 970 / AMD Radeon R9 390 DirectX: Version 11 Storage: 21 GB available space VR Support: OpenXR Additional Notes: Minimum Specs are for VR, lower specs may work for Non-VR.

Recommended

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system OS: Windows 10 64Bit Processor: Intel Core i5-10600 / AMD Ryzen 5 3600 Memory: 8 GB RAM Graphics: NVIDIA RTX 2060 / AMD Radeon RX 5700 DirectX: Version 11 Network: Broadband Internet connection Storage: 21 GB available space

Requirements sourced from the official Steam store listing.
